East San Lorenzo is a Small Island spanning 1 km² with a coastline of 8.5 km.

Archipel: Alexander Archipelago – A group of about 1,100 islands off the southeast coast of Alaska, USA, known for their temperate rainforests and indigenous Tlingit culture.

Tectonic Plate: North America – Covers North America and parts of the Atlantic and Arctic Oceans, characterized by diverse geological features and varying levels of seismic activity.

The mean elevation is 42 m. The highest elevation on the island reaches approximately 120 meters above sea level. The island is characterized by Plains: Flat, low-lying lands characterized by a maximum elevation of up to 200 meters. On islands, plains are typically coastal lowlands or central flat areas.

Dominating Vegetation: Evergreen Needleleaf Forest
Dominated by evergreen coniferous trees such as pines and firs, which retain their needle-like leaves throughout the year. These forests are often found in cooler climates. East San Lorenzo has a tree cover of 53 %.

There is no public and scheduled airport on East San Lorenzo. The nearest airport is Port Protection Seaplane Base, located 81 km away.

Does the island have a major port? no.
There are no major ports on East San Lorenzo. The closest major port is STEAMBOAT BAY, approximately 7 km away.

The mean population of East San Lorenzo is 0 per km². East San Lorenzo is Uninhabited. The island belongs to United States of America.
